WebApr 3, 2024 · PAM-XIAMEN offers undoped GaAs wafer, which is also called semi-insulating GaAs wafer. Undoped gallium arsenide wafer is applied to the field of microelectronics and mainly used to make radio frequency (RF) power devices. GaAs single crystal growth methods include VGF, VB, and LEC. The gallium arsenide ingots are wax-mounted to a graphite beam and sawed into individual wafers with the use an automatic inner diameter blade saw. Lubricants used in this operation generate a gallium arsenide slurry, which is collected, centrifuged, and recycled.
